What Is the Difference Between Dizziness and Vertigo?

Many people use the terms “dizziness” and “vertigo” interchangeably, but the sensations and causes are actually very different. Dizziness is usually a temporary symptom of general imbalance, while vertigo symptoms are associated with the sufferer’s entire world spinning around due to an inner ear issue. Do I Need to Worry About Scoliosis?

Scoliosis is a condition that starts in the spine but can affect the entire body. If you have scoliosis, it means that your spine has a curve to it when it should be straight. Your vertebrae make an “S” or “C” shape instead of being stacked on top of each other. Is Mesenteric Adenitis Cause for Concern?

Mesenteric adenitis is a relatively common condition, and although anyone at any age can get it, it most often affects children and teens. Despite its scary-sounding name, mesenteric adenitis isn’t usually very serious and will clear up on its own in a week or two in most cases.
